Safety
Treadmills are now a sought-after piece of exercise equipment, both for commercial and home use. They are powered by an electric motor, they permit users to walk or run in pre-set speeds. Many treadmills also come with an incline setting to simulate running uphill or downhill. While treadmills that are electric offer convenience but they also pose a risk to safety in the event of misuse. Accidents involving treadmills are quite common and range from minor to severe. This is why it is important to familiarize yourself with treadmill portable electric safety guidelines and to practice safe exercises while using the equipment.
One of the most crucial treadmill safety features is the safety crucial. This small accessory is designed to force all electric treadmills to stop when pulled. The safety key acts as an emergency brake that could prevent entrapment injuries or deaths like those that have been mentioned in numerous lawsuits involving treadmill entanglement. It is possible to bypass the safety key on treadmills (a popular DIY option on YouTube) however doing so could lead to injuries or even death. The safety key must be placed in a place that is easily identifiable for instance, in the middle of the console.
When selecting a treadmill, it is important to choose a model with an deck that can be reversible. A treadmill deck that can be reversible lets the user to flip the belt layer as it begins to wear out, extending the life of the treadmill. Reversible decks can also help reduce noise from the treadmill's belt moving across the surface.
Another important safety tip for treadmills is to always read the user manual for specific instructions on how to set up and operate the treadmill. The manual will likely offer recommendations for proper stance while running on the treadmill. The manual will typically recommend a minimum distance of 6 to 8 feet between the treadmill and other objects. Insufficient clearance can cause objects to become trapped in the belts of running and result in severe friction burns, fractured bones, sprains, or even traumatizing injuries.
In addition to the safety precautions mentioned above, it is crucial to examine the treadmill's power cord on a regular basis for any signs of wear and tear. Power cords can pose an entanglement risk for children and should be kept out of reach when not in use. It is not recommended to leave the treadmill electric vs manual plugged in unattended.

Noise
As you walk or run on treadmills, the pounding of your feet against the deck and the whirring noises of motors and moving parts produce a certain amount noise. This can be distracting if you are using your treadmill in a space shared like an apartment shared with roommates or in the event that your family members are watching TV nearby. This can be a distraction while listening to music or podcasts.
An electric treadmill uses an electric motor to create constant rotations of the belt. The motor is able to adjust the speed and incline you prefer, making it easy for you to get the most of your workout. These treadmills are usually located in gyms, and they are equipped with numerous bells and whistles that keep you interested.
It is normal for treadmills to make some noises when you first begin using it. These sounds will disappear after a few weeks of regular use. They are normal and not to be avoided because the treadmill is adjusting to your movements and is lubricating the running belt. There are some squeaks that can occur, but they are able to be dealt with quickly by using a special lubricant on your machine.
A humming sound coming from your treadmill can be a sign that something is not right with the treadmill. It could be due to a issue with the belt, malfunctioning motor or other electrical issues. It is crucial to follow the maintenance instructions in your manual and [empty] seek help from a professional if you are not familiar with electrical work.
